Title: 1H and 15N Chemical Shift Assignments for ribosomal protein L7
Deposition date: 1999-10-03 Original release date: 2002-07-12
Authors: Bocharov, Eduard
Citation: Bocharov, Eduard; Gudkov, Anatolij; Arseniev, Alexandr. "Topology of the secondary structure elements of ribosomal protein L7/L12 from E.coli in solutio" FEBS Lett. 379, 291-294 (1996).
Assembly members:
E.coli ribosomal protein L7/L12, polymer, 120 residues,   12164 Da.
Natural source: Common Name: E. coli Taxonomy ID: 562 Superkingdom: Eubacteria Kingdom: not available Genus/species: Escherichia coli
Experimental source: Production method: recombinant technology Host organism: Escherichia coli

Samples:
sample_1: E.coli ribosomal protein L7/L12, [U-95% 15N], 1.0 mM
sample_cond_1: pH: 6.9; temperature: 303 K; ionic strength: 0.15 M
Experiments:
| Name | Sample | Sample state | Sample conditions | 
|---|---|---|---|
| 1H-15N HMQC | sample_1 | not available | sample_cond_1 | 
| 1H-15N HSQC | sample_1 | not available | sample_cond_1 | 
| 1H-15N TOCSY-HSQC | sample_1 | not available | sample_cond_1 | 
| 1H-15N NOESY-HSQC | sample_1 | not available | sample_cond_1 | 
| 1H TOCSY | sample_1 | not available | sample_cond_1 | 
| 1H NOESY | sample_1 | not available | sample_cond_1 | 
Software:
XEASY v1.2.11 - peak assignments
DYANA v1.5 - structure calculation
FANTOM v4 - energy minimization
MOLMOL v2.5.1 - visualization and structure analysis
NMR spectrometers:
- Varian UNITY 600 MHz
